    “I have been an NHS patient with Abbey House Dental for many years now. When it became clear however that one of my lower molars was unable to be saved I had to start weighing up my options. In the end it turned out these were either a root canal, denture or an implant. Most of you reading this will know advanced options for dental help like Implants on the NHS are not funded - that is another discussion. After researching I came to the conclusion because it is such an important tooth that I needed to go for the implant. In the longer run I believe it will be the best decision. My dentist referred me to the Advanced Center where I talked to Mana, the treatment co-ordinator. The initial consultation is when you find out how much an implant is going to cost. Like most people (I imagine) my reaction to this was one of eye watering incredulity. Having since thought about it, I have softened a little given the team, the equipment, the skills of the professionals involved and the procedure. Even so, this puts Implants beyond the reach of many people which is unfortunate. Looking around other places is the same, there are some cheaper options, even going abroad but in the end I needed to get it done and by a team I could trust.

Having decided it was my best option. I had an appointment with Dr Rehan where he explained the procedure clearly, answering my questions along the way. My treatment co-ordinator, Mand took a full 3D scan of my mouth, the results of which are mapped out and used to come up with the shape of the implant tooth. There’s some tech at work here. The appt was made for 2 weeks, especially important to me that it was as soon as possible as my tooth at this point had split in half above the gum and it was important to get it out. The dentist did explain at this point that this might make the removal a little harder. The first part of the procedure is to remove the broken tooth and install the implant screw. I was a little nervous. In the end the team injected my gum around the tooth and numbed it. For my operation there was a team of four. Another dentist came up during the procedure to help with extraction as this turned out to give Dr Rehan a number of challenges - basically without sounding too screamish, the extraction wasn’t straight forward as feared. To cut a long story short, I was impressed by the way the team dealt with it. I understand sometimes things don’t go to plan and the team Dr Rehan, another dentist from downstairs and (I think) Wioleta provided an outstanding service and level of care. It was uncomfortable at times for me, but I always felt like I was in good hands. I should mention in this review that clinic is impressive in terms of equipment and cleanliness - always a good sign. After around an hour, the operation to put the implant screw was a success. I did need to be topped up a couple of times to keep the area numb but the team made sure I was not in pain. I was shown the x-ray of the area and could see that the implant had gone in just the correct angle which was a relief. The implant screw had to go in a little deeper due to my bone density. I was given some antibiotics and mouthwash. Relieved but with a sore mouth (no blame attached of course it was going to be sore) I headed to the pharmacy and got some pain relief. First stage complete. I will be back shortly to have the implant fitted. Despite my moans about the cost I can’t fault the service or the team so I highly recommend.”
